Micro-Air EasyTouch RV Thermostat: Installation, Operation, and Smart Device Connectivity

The Micro-Air EasyTouch RV thermostat is designed for use in recreational vehicles. Installation involves removing an existing thermostat and connecting wiring to the EasyTouch unit. The system supports single and multi-zone configurations, with compatibility noted for Coleman, Airxcel, and RV Products units, excluding ZC and dual-stage 1 models. Operation is managed through the device interface and via Bluetooth and Wi-Fi connectivity, enabling control through dedicated smart device applications available on both iOS and Android platforms. The thermostat includes features such as temperature setting, fan speed control, and scheduling options.

Installation Procedures

Installation of the Micro-Air EasyTouch RV thermostat is performed via an external wall mount. The documentation details procedures for different zone configurations.

For Single Zone DC (ASY-352) installations, the process begins with gently pushing upwards on the bottom of the original thermostat to release it from the wall.

Multi-Zone OEM (ASY-350) and Single-Zone OEM (ASY-351) installations are also performed by removing the existing thermostat from its wall mount.

Following removal of the existing thermostat, the installation continues with securing the wall mounting bracket. This involves screwing the bracket into wall anchors using the provided screws. After tightening the screws, the center plastic spacer is removed. The thermostat cable is then connected to the EasyTouch RV thermostat. Finally, the thermostat mounting pins are inserted into the back of the thermostat, aligning them with the provided holes, while simultaneously pressing the unit against the wall to secure it.

Basic Operations and Interface

The EasyTouch RV thermostat offers several basic operational functions. Users can adjust the temperature, select the source, control fan speed, and switch between “Home” and “Away” modes. The thermostat also allows selection between Fahrenheit and Celsius temperature scales. Brightness adjustment is also a supported function.

The thermostat interface displays image icons to indicate system status. These icons represent states such as “System off” and “System on,” as well as settings options. Further details regarding the specific meaning of each icon are found in Appendix I of the provided documentation.

Smart Device Applications

The Micro-Air EasyTouch RV thermostat is compatible with smart devices running either the iOS or Android operating systems. Dedicated applications for both platforms are available for download from the Apple App Store and Google Play. These applications can be located by searching for “EasyTouch RV.” The applications are offered as a free download.
